    POSITION SUMMARY:

    We have an exciting opportunity to join our team as a Simulation Operations Associate. The primary function of the Simulation Operations Associate (SOA) is to support the delivery of an on-site or off-site simulation activity. The Simulation Operations Associate reports directly to the Assistant Director of Operations.

     

     

    JOB RESPONSIBILITIES:

    • Perform other related duties as assigned
    • Adhere to NYSIM Policy & Procedures
    • Maintain proficiency in existing and emerging technologies through the guidance of peers and leadership
    • Integrate strategic goals into daily activities
    • Ensure safe and appropriate use of center resources (space, equipment and software)
    • Educate faculty on equipment and space utilization and software, as needed and appropriate
    • Participate in relevant internal and external meetings
    • Close facilities as per Standard Operating Procedure
    • Open facilities as per Standard Operating Procedure
    • Maintain inventory as per Standard Operating Procedure
    • Maintain rooms as per Standard Operating Procedure
    • Maintain equipment as per Standard operating Procedure
    • Escalate to leadership as necessary (i.e. issues, concerns, faculty questions, feedback)
    • Welcome and support programs; acknowledge by greeting faculty and introduce yourself by telling the faculty your first and last name; explain support the program and contact method for the duration of the program.
    • Breakdown for programs: space, equipment and software
    • Set up for programs: space, equipment and software

     

     

    MINIMUM QUALIFICATIONS:

    Bachelor's Degree and/or two to three years of relevant experience. Demonstrate superior oral and written communication skills as well as strong organizational skills. Demonstrate ability to work with a diverse population and as part of a team.

     

    PREFERRED QUALIFICATIONS: Previous work experience in healthcare.
